How it works

The programme is hugely flexible and is initially designed to be used with a small group of young people by a teacher, T.A. learning mentor or pastoral lead. We recommend this to be one designated person who will become your ‘in-house’ A Confident ME coach.

With experience of using our fully comprehensive programme the coach will become an expert in the resource and with this insight can start using the programme with greater flexibility. For example identifying young people’s specific needs and matching them with certain aspects of the programme in targeted groups as well as working one to one. Additionally, certain workshops are ideal for whole class Mental Health theme days.

Each workshop features 8 sections

Mindful Moments

In our mindful moments we learn that all emotions are okay, we practice being with our thoughts and feelings as well as letting them go. This practice of quieting the mind helps tune into our inner peace, a place we have within us all, a refuge. Throughout the course we learn breathing techniques, peer massage and mindfulness activities, all of which improve concentration, focus and overall wellbeing.

Brain Box

This section is packed with enlightening neuroscience and positive psychology that underpins much of what is included in the course. Simply understanding the basics of how the brain works and how incredibly malleable it is, allows us to feel more powerful than we can ever imagine. This knowledge unlocks the belief that we can ALL achieve great things. Brain box is a vital part of becoming A Confident ME.

Mindset Matters

During Mindset Matters we recognise how our emotional state has the power, if we let it, to control us. We learn to accept that life will not always be fun or easy, and how to manage those difficult moments. In this section we put into action the skills of mindfulness, mindset shifting as well as the knowledge we have learnt in our Brain Box section.

Stronger Together Newsletter

This section of the course comes home to caregivers in the form of a weekly newsletter.  It contains an outline of the session, activities to continue and complete at home and an explanation of how the caregiver can get involved too. We recognise that the caregiver is a powerful role and we are all striving to impact our children’s lives in a positive way.  The ‘Stronger Together Newsletter’ is a vital key to the success of the Confident ME Programme.
